This AI-generated tattoo project presents a refined botanical study titled Lily of the Valley, rendered in black and grey with precise, ultra-fine linework. The composition centers on a graceful stem that arches upward from a robust base, its broad leaves curling toward the viewer while a string of tiny, bell-shaped blossoms threads along the stem in a soft cascade. Each element is reduced to essential outlines, with light cross-hatching and subtle shading to suggest depth without overwhelming the delicacy of the linework. The background remains intentionally unobtrusive, allowing the ink to read clearly as a standalone piece or integrated into a broader botanical sleeve. Symbolically, lily of the valley conveys humility, renewal, and quiet happiness — themes that translate well into a meaningful tattoo design for someone seeking a restrained, refined statement. The black and grey palette reinforces timeless elegance and makes the motif versatile across skin tones; the fine-line approach ensures legibility on small areas such as wrists or behind-the-ear, while still offering the option to scale up for a larger botanical study. From a technique perspective, this project emphasizes clean contour work, balanced spacing, and gentle shading that preserves negative space, delivering a sophisticated look suitable for a modern body art collection.
